<?php

namespace Helpers;

set_time_limit(0);

define('DS', DIRECTORY_SEPARATOR); // I always use this short form in my code.

class Helper
{

    public static function checkOs()
    {
        $os_name=PHP_OS;
        if(strpos($os_name,"Linux")!==false){
            $os_flag = 'Linux';
        }else if(strpos($os_name,"WIN")!==false){
            $os_flag = 'Win';
        }

        return $os_flag;
    }

    /**
     * @param $filename
     * @param int $n
     * @return bool|string
     */
    public static function getLastLines($filename, $n=1)
    {
        if(!$fp=fopen($filename,'r')){
            echo "打开文件失败,请检查文件路径是否正确,路径和文件名不要包含中文";
            return false;
        }

        $pos=-2;
        $eof="";
        $str="";

        while($n>0){
            while($eof!="\n"){
                if(!fseek($fp,$pos,SEEK_END)){
                    $eof=fgetc($fp);
                    $pos--;
                }else{
                    break;
                }
            }

            $str.=fgets($fp);
            $eof="";
            $n--;
        }

        return $str;
    }

    public static function downloadFile($file_path)
    {
        $fileinfo = pathinfo($file_path);
        header('Content-type: application/x-'.$fileinfo['extension']);
        header('Content-Disposition: attachment; filename='.$fileinfo['basename']);
        header('Content-Length: '.filesize($file_path));
        readfile($file_path);
    }

    public static function arrIconv($input_charset='GBK', $output_charset='UTF-8', $arr)
    {
        $return = array();

        if(is_array($arr)) {
            foreach($arr as $k=>$item) {
                if(is_array($item)) {
                    $return[$k] = self::arrIconv($input_charset, $output_charset, $item);
                } else {
                    $return[$k] = iconv($input_charset, $output_charset, $item);
                }
            }
        } else {
            $return = iconv($input_charset, $output_charset, $arr);
        }

        return $return;
    }

    public static function copyR($path, $dest) { // 原目录,复制到的目录

        if( is_dir($path) ) {
            @mkdir( $dest );
            $objects = scandir($path);
            if( sizeof($objects) > 0 ) {
                foreach( $objects as $file ) {
                    if( $file == "." || $file == ".." ) {
                        continue;
                    }

                    // go on
                    if( is_dir( $path.DS.$file ) ) {
                        self::copyR( $path.DS.$file, $dest.DS.$file );
                    } else {
                        copy( $path.DS.$file, $dest.DS.$file );
                    }
                }
            }

            return true;

        } elseif( is_file($path) ) {
            return copy($path, $dest);
        } else {
            return false;
        }
    }

    public static function getDirList($dir_path)
    {
        if(!is_dir($dir_path)) {
            return false;
        }

        $dir_list = array();

        $d = dir($dir_path);
        if ($d) {
            while (false !== ($entry = $d->read())) {
                if ($entry != '.' && $entry != '..') {
                    $k = str_replace(array('-', '_'), array(''), $entry);
                    preg_match('/(\d+)/', $k, $matches);
                    $dir_list[$matches[0]] = $entry;
                }
            }

            $d->close();
        }

        ksort($dir_list);

        return $dir_list;
    }

    public static function random($length, $numeric = 0)
    {
        $seed = base_convert(md5(microtime().$_SERVER['DOCUMENT_ROOT']), 16, $numeric ? 10 : 35);
        $seed = $numeric ? (str_replace('0', '', $seed).'012340567890') : ($seed.'zZ'.strtoupper($seed));

        if($numeric) {
            $hash = '';
        } else {
            $hash = chr(rand(1, 26) + rand(0, 1) * 32 + 64);
            $length--;
        }

        $max = strlen($seed) - 1;
        for($i = 0; $i < $length; $i++) {
            $hash .= $seed{mt_rand(0, $max)};
        }

        return $hash;
    }

    public static function delDir($dir)
    {
        if(strtoupper(substr(PHP_OS, 0, 3)) == 'WIN') {
            $str = "rmdir /s/q " . $dir;
        } else {
            $str = "rm -Rf " . $dir;
        }

        exec($str, $result, $return_var);
        return true;
    }

    /**
     * @see pcntl_waitpid()
     */
    public static function waitpid($pid, &$status=0, $flag = WNOHANG) {
        return pcntl_waitpid($pid, $status, $flag);
    }

    /**
     * @see posix_kill()
     */
    public static function kill($pid) {
        return posix_kill($pid, SIGTERM);
    }

    public static function lockFile($file_path='/tmp/file_lock.lock')
    {
        $fp = fopen($file_path, "w+");
        if(flock($fp, LOCK_EX)) {
            fwrite($fp, date('Y-m-d H:i:s', time())."---pid[".posix_getpid()."]---lock suc!\n");
            return $fp;
        } else {
       fclose($fp);
return false; } } public static function freeLock($fp) { fflush($fp); flock($fp, LOCK_UN); fclose($fp); } }
